From 64dabfa605cefc5b25b07c1a0a50479b8ad749cb Mon Sep 17 00:00:00 2001 From: Benoit Pierre Date: Sat, 23 Nov 2024 19:28:57 +0100 Subject: [PATCH] tests: speedup persist huge tables test (#12786)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it For example on my machine: | test duration (ms) | master | PR | | :- | -: | -: | | regular run | 859.82 | 104.38 (÷8.2) | | coverage run | 40735.60 | 4151.34 (÷9.8) | --- spec/unit/persist_spec.lua |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/spec/unit/persist_spec.lua b/spec/unit/persist_spec.lua index 1829636c6..7f8e5f208 100644 --- a/spec/unit/persist_spec.lua +++ b/spec/unit/persist_spec.lua @@ -95,7 +95,7 @@ describe("Persist module", function() end) it("should work with huge tables", function() - local tab = arrayOf(100000) + local tab = arrayOf(10000) for _, codec in ipairs({"bitser", "luajit"}) do local ser = Persist.getCodec(codec).serialize local deser = Persist.getCodec(codec).deserialize